Enabling and Disabling the DCD Setting

104
When the X server starts, it checks the user-defined display setting to ensure that it is
valid for the current hardware configuration. If a display setting is not specified or if it is
invalid, the X server automatically selects the default setting. If you do not want to use
the default setting, follow these steps:
Note: Make sure that both of the monitors that are connected to a single DCD have the
same or similar display capabilities.
1.
Open a UNIX shell.
2. Start xsetmon.
The Graphics Back End Control window appears, as shown in the example in
Figure 4-1.
